Denarius depicting Pax (personification) holding a cornucopia; attributes include a twig. Obverse: Head of Septimius Severus (Roman emperor, 146–211) with laurel wreath facing right, inscribed LSEPTSEVPERTAVGIMP. Reverse: Concordia? seated facing left, holding cornucopia in left hand. Date: 194–198. Roman Empire (27 BC–476). Coin diameter 18.0–18.5 mm; weight 3.14 g.
